Intra-articular injection of etoricoxib-loaded PLGA-PEG-PLGA triblock copolymeric nanoparticles attenuates osteoarthritis progression.

Abstract

The current pharmacological therapies for osteoarthritis (OA) are mainly focused on symptomatic relief of pain and inflammation through the use of n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). Etoricoxib is a cyclooxygenase-2 (COX-2) selective NSAID with a higher cyclooxygenase-1 (COX-1) to COX-2 selectivity ratio than the other COX-2 selective NSAIDs and a lower risk of gastrointestinal toxicity compared to traditional NSAIDs. In this study, we first evaluated the anti-inflammatory and chondro-protective effects of etoricoxib on interlecukin-1β-stimulated human osteoarthritic chondrocytes. We found that etoricoxib not only inhibited the expression of inflammation mediators COX-2, prostaglandin E2 (PGE2), and nitric oxide, but also had a similar chondro-protective effect to celecoxib through down-regulating matrix degrading enzymes matrix metalloproteinase-13 (MMP-13) and a disintegrin and metalloproteinase with thrombospondin motifs (ADAMTS-5). We then used PLGA-PEG-PLGA triblock copolymeric nanoparticles (NPs) as a drug delivery system to locally deliver etoricoxib into the articular cavity to reduce the risk of cardiovascular toxicity of etoricoxib when administered systemically or orally. The etoricoxib-loaded NPs showed a sustained drug release over 28 days in vitro; in rat OA model, the intra-articular injection of etoricoxib-loaded NPs alleviated the symptoms of subchondral bone, synovium, and cartilage. In conclusion, our study confirmed the chondro-protective role of etoricoxib in OA, and proved the curative effects of etoricoxib-loaded PLGA-PEG-PLGA NPs in vivo. AJTR
